Nutrition Facts
per 100g
Calories 405
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 3.6g 5%
Saturated Fat 0.0g 0%
Cholesterol 0mg 0%
Sodium 452mg 20%
Total Carbohydrate 43.9g 16%
Dietary Fiber 0.0g 0%
Total Sugars 40.5g -
Protein 47.6g 95%
Vitamins & Minerals
Vitamin A 0.0μg 0%
Vitamin C 0.0mg 0%
Vitamin D 0.0μg 0%
Vitamin E 0.1mg 1%
Vitamin K 2.7μg 2%
Vitamin B6 0.1mg 3%
Vitamin B12 0.0μg 0%
Thiamine 0.1mg 8%
Riboflavin 0.1mg 4%
Niacin 0.8mg 5%
Folate 100.0μg 25%
Choline 114.0mg 21%
Calcium 95.0mg 7%
Iron 6.4mg 36%
Potassium 714.0mg 15%
Magnesium 22.0mg 5%
Phosphorus 441.0mg 35%
Zinc 2.3mg 21%
Selenium 0.7μg 1%
Copper 1.0mg 111%
Monounsaturated Fat 0.64g
Polyunsaturated Fat 1.96g
Omega-3 0.00g
DHA 0.00g
EPA 0.00g
Other
Caffeine 0.0mg
Theobromine 0.0mg

FAQ

EAS Soy Protein Powder contains 405 calories per 100g serving. This makes it a calorie-dense option for those looking to increase their protein intake.

EAS Soy Protein Powder can be a healthy option, especially for those seeking high protein content with low fat. It has 47.6g of protein and only 3.57g of total fat per 100g.

Each 100g serving of EAS Soy Protein Powder contains a substantial 47.6g of protein. This high protein content makes it ideal for muscle recovery and growth.

EAS Soy Protein Powder has a relatively high carbohydrate content at 43.9g per 100g, which may not be suitable for strict keto diets that limit carbs significantly.

The recommended daily intake of protein varies by individual needs, but incorporating EAS Soy Protein Powder as part of your overall protein goals can be beneficial. Always consider your total dietary intake.

EAS Soy Protein Powder offers a plant-based protein source with 47.6g of protein per 100g, while whey protein typically has similar or slightly higher protein content but comes from dairy. Choose based on dietary preferences.
